Smart Personalized Routing for Smart Cities

In smart cities, commuters have the opportunities for smart routing that may enable selecting a route with less car accidents, or one that is more scenic, or perhaps a straight and flat route. Such smart personalization requires a data management framework that goes beyond a static road network graph. This paper introduces PreGo, a novel system developed to provide real time personalized routing. The recommended routes by PreGo are smart and personalized in the sense of being (1) adjustable to individual users preferences, (2) subjective to the trip start time, and (3) sensitive to changes of the road conditions. Extensive experimental evaluation using real and synthetic data demonstrates the efficiency of the PreGo system.

[1]  Abdeltawab M. Hendawi,et al.  Dynamic and Personalized Routing in PreGo , 2016, 2016 17th IEEE International Conference on Mobile Data Management (MDM).

[2]  Leo Liberti,et al.  Bidirectional A* Search for Time-Dependent Fast Paths , 2008, WEA.

[3]  Karl Aberer,et al.  Semantic Data Layers in Air Quality Monitoring for Smarter Cities , 2015, S4SC@ISWC.

[4]  A. Guttman,et al.  A Dynamic Index Structure for Spatial Searching , 1984, SIGMOD 1984.

[5]  Nils J. Nilsson,et al.  A Formal Basis for the Heuristic Determination of Minimum Cost Paths , 1968, IEEE Trans. Syst. Sci. Cybern..

[6]  Matthias Schubert,et al.  Mining Driving Preferences in Multi-cost Networks , 2013, SSTD.

[7]  Thambipillai Srikanthan,et al.  Heuristic techniques for accelerating hierarchical routing on road networks , 2002, IEEE Trans. Intell. Transp. Syst..

[8]  Shashi Shekhar,et al.  Spatio-temporal Network Databases and Routing Algorithms: A Summary of Results , 2007, SSTD.

[9]  Christian S. Jensen,et al.  Vehicle Routing with User-Generated Trajectory Data , 2015, 2015 16th IEEE International Conference on Mobile Data Management.

[10]  Yu Zheng,et al.  Constructing popular routes from uncertain trajectories , 2012, KDD.

[11]  Christian S. Jensen,et al.  Toward personalized, context-aware routing , 2015, The VLDB Journal.

[12]  Kikuo Fujimura Path planning with multiple objectives , 1996, IEEE Robotics Autom. Mag..

[13]  Arnab Bhattacharya,et al.  A continuous query system for dynamic route planning , 2011, 2011 IEEE 27th International Conference on Data Engineering.

[14]  Abdeltawab M. Hendawi,et al.  A vision for micro and macro location aware services , 2016, SIGSPATIAL/GIS.

[15]  Jiajie Xu,et al.  Traffic Aware Route Planning in Dynamic Road Networks , 2012, DASFAA.

[16]  Dimitris Sacharidis,et al.  Dynamic Pickup and Delivery with Transfers , 2011, SSTD.

[17]  Muhammad Tayyab Asif,et al.  Online map-matching based on Hidden Markov model for real-time traffic sensing applications , 2012, 2012 15th International IEEE Conference on Intelligent Transportation Systems.

[18]  Antonin Guttman,et al.  R-trees: a dynamic index structure for spatial searching , 1984, SIGMOD '84.

[19]  Hao Wu,et al.  R3: A Real-Time Route Recommendation System , 2014, Proc. VLDB Endow..

[20]  V. Shanthi,et al.  Goal Directed Relative Skyline Queries in Time Dependent Road Networks , 2012, ArXiv.

[21]  Ahmed Eldawy,et al.  TAREEG: a MapReduce-based web service for extracting spatial data from OpenStreetMap , 2014, SIGMOD Conference.

[22]  Hanan Samet,et al.  Scalable network distance browsing in spatial databases , 2008, SIGMOD Conference.

[23]  Andrew V. Goldberg,et al.  Navigation made personal: inferring driving preferences from GPS traces , 2015, SIGSPATIAL/GIS.

[24]  Edsger W. Dijkstra,et al.  A note on two problems in connexion with graphs , 1959, Numerische Mathematik.

[25]  Georgios K. Ouzounis,et al.  Smart cities of the future , 2012, The European Physical Journal Special Topics.

[26]  Abdeltawab M. Hendawi,et al.  CrowdPath: A Framework for Next Generation Routing Services Using Volunteered Geographic Information , 2013, SSTD.

[27]  Mahmoud Reza Delavar,et al.  Multi-criteria, personalized route planning using quantifier-guided ordered weighted averaging operators , 2011, Int. J. Appl. Earth Obs. Geoinformation.

[28]  Elke A. Rundensteiner,et al.  Hierarchical optimization of optimal path finding for transportation applications , 1996, CIKM '96.

[29]  Hans-Peter Kriegel,et al.  MARiO: Multi-Attribute Routing in Open Street Map , 2011, SSTD.

[30]  Hanan Samet,et al.  Query Processing Using Distance Oracles for Spatial Networks , 2010, IEEE Transactions on Knowledge and Data Engineering.

[31]  Eric Horvitz,et al.  Trip Router with Individualized Preferences (TRIP): Incorporating Personalization into Route Planning , 2006, AAAI.

[32]  Jiawei Han,et al.  Adaptive Fastest Path Computation on a Road Network: A Traffic Mining Approach , 2007, VLDB.

[33]  Weifa Liang,et al.  Energy-efficient skyline query processing and maintenance in sensor networks , 2008, CIKM '08.